Tell me about a time you influenced a team without authority in a Apple-style product environment

Problem Statement Description

Product context: Apple is a consumer hardware, software, and services company; its products include iPhone, iPad, Mac, Apple Watch, AirPods, iOS, App Store, iCloud, Apple Music, and Apple TV+.

Describe a specific situation where you needed to influence teammates, partners, or stakeholders without having formal authority over them in an Apple-style product environment. The example should be relevant to premium consumer technology, such as iPhone hardware-software experiences, privacy-conscious users, ecosystem quality, accessibility, or tightly integrated product decisions.

Your story should show how you built alignment across functions such as design, engineering, privacy, legal, data, marketing, operations, or leadership when priorities were not automatically aligned. Focus on what made the influence challenge real: competing goals, limited information, strong opinions, user trust concerns, schedule pressure, or the need to protect a high-quality user experience.

The interviewer is looking for evidence of practical leadership, judgment, communication, and collaboration—not positional power. Choose an example where your actions changed the team’s direction, improved the product outcome, or helped the group make a better decision.

The experience should consider:

- The product context, user problem, and why the decision mattered to customers

- Who you needed to influence and why you did not have direct authority over them

- The disagreement, ambiguity, or resistance you faced

- How you used data, user insight, product principles, prototypes, or clear reasoning to build alignment

- How you balanced privacy, user experience, technical feasibility, business goals, and execution constraints

- The specific actions you personally took to move the team forward

- The measurable or observable impact of your influence

- What you learned and how it shaped your approach to cross-functional product leadership

The goal is to demonstrate that you can earn trust, create alignment, and drive high-quality product outcomes in a collaborative environment where influence depends on clarity, credibility, customer focus, and thoughtful trade-off management.
